The global market for bioactive wound dressings is projected to experience consistent growth over the next decade as clinical practices shift toward advanced materials designed to support tissue repair. Industry data indicates that the sector is expected to expand from a valuation of approximately $1.0 billion in 2026 to $2.6 billion by 2036. This growth reflects an increasing focus on wound-bed optimization and the management of chronic conditions such as diabetic foot ulcers and pressure ulcers within healthcare facilities.
The shift toward bioactive wound dressings represents a change in how healthcare systems manage chronic wounds, moving away from passive coverage to materials that interact with the wound environment. This transition is largely driven by the clinical need to address the underlying biological barriers that prevent healing in complex cases. As hospitals and specialized clinics seek to reduce the long-term costs associated with recurring wounds and infections, the demand for standardized, evidence-based dressings is expected to rise. This trend highlights the prioritization of healing outcomes and the integration of advanced materials into routine treatment protocols across various care settings.
Despite the projected growth, the industry faces challenges related to the higher cost of these materials compared to traditional foam or hydrocolloid options. Healthcare providers often require substantial clinical data to justify the procurement of these advanced products, which can complicate reimbursement processes. Additionally, the effective use of these technologies often necessitates specialized training and precise application techniques, particularly as treatment moves into home healthcare environments. The future competitive landscape will likely be determined by the ability of manufacturers to provide verifiable clinical evidence that demonstrates the efficacy of these materials in diverse patient populations while navigating the complexities of healthcare funding and documentation requirements.
